                       104TH CONGRESS                                            REPT. 104-802
                          2d Session       H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ES                  Part 1






                        NATIONAL PARK SERVICE ADMINISTRATIVE REFORM ACT
                                                        OF 1996




                         SEPTEMBER 17, 1996.-Committed to the Committee of the Whole House on the
                                         State of the Union and ordered to be printed



                             Mr. YOUNG of Alaska, from the Committee on Resources,
                                               submitted the following


                                                   REPORT

                                                 [To accompany H.R. 2941]

                                  [Including cost estimate of the Congressional Budget Office]

                         The Committee on Resources, to whom was referred the bill
                       (H.R. 2941) to improve the quantity and quality of the quarters of
                       land management agency field employees, and for other purposes,
                       having considered the same, report favorably thereon with an
                       amendment and recommend that the bill as amended do pass.
                         The amendment is as follows:
                         Strike out all after the enacting clause and insert in lieu thereof
                       the following:
                       S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E AND TABLE OF CONTENTS.
                         (a) SHORT TITLE.-This Act may be cited as the National Park Service Adminis-
                       trative Reform Act of 1996.
                         (b) TABLE OF CONTENTS.-The table of contents for this Act is as follows:
                       Sec. 1. Short title and table of contents.
                       Sec. 2. National Park Service Housing Improvement Act.
                       Sec. 3. Minor boundary revision authority.
                       Sec. 4. Authorization for certain park facilities to be located outside of units of the National Park System.
                       Sec. 5. Elimination of unnecessary congressional reporting requirements.
                       Sec. 6. Senate confirmation of the Director of the National Park Service.
                       Sec. 7. National Park System Advisory Board authorization.
                       Sec. 8. Challenge cost-share agreement authority.
                       Sec. 9. Cost recovery for damage to national park resources.
                       SEC. 2. NATIONAL PARK SERVICE HOUSING IMPROVEMENT ACT.
                         (a) PURPOSES.-The purposes of this section are-
                            (1) to develop where necessary an adequate supply of quality housing units
                          for field employees of the National Park Service within a reasonable time frame;
                            (2) to expand the alternatives available for construction and repair of essen-
                          tial government housing;
                            (3) to rely on the private sector to finance or supply housing in carrying out
                          this section, to the maximum extent possible, in order to reduce the need for
                          Federal appropriations;
